pkg/party models each endpoint of the system as a separate object holding only its own private state, wired together through the transport bus. - ceremony.go: NewCeremony bootstraps the Ed25519 root CA, enrolls all parties (setup, 4 CCs, electoral board, voting server, verifier, N voters) with CA-signed identity certs, registers each in the directory, and wires its handler into the bus. - parties.go: the six party types and a shared hello/ack handshake; Handshake() proves the full sign -> route -> verify -> reply -> verify path for every party before any election logic runs. - state.go: per-party private state structs (nothing shared across parties). - transcript.go: PublicTranscript, the append-only bulletin board a remote verifier will consume (no secrets). - phases.go: phase handlers reject unknown message types cleanly (the transport boundary never panics on unexpected input) — filled in over the next commits.
